func TestClientTransfer(t *testing.T) {
	greetingTempDir, mi := testutil.GreetingTestTorrent()
	defer os.RemoveAll(greetingTempDir)
	cfg := TestingConfig
	cfg.Seed = true
	cfg.DataDir = greetingTempDir
	seeder, err := NewClient(&cfg)
	if err != nil {
		t.Fatal(err)
	}
	defer seeder.Close()
	seeder.AddTorrentSpec(TorrentSpecFromMetaInfo(mi))
	leecherDataDir, err := ioutil.TempDir("", "")
	if err != nil {
		t.Fatal(err)
	}
	defer os.RemoveAll(leecherDataDir)
	// cfg.TorrentDataOpener = func(info *metainfo.Info) (data.Data, error) {
	// 	return blob.TorrentData(info, leecherDataDir), nil
	// }
	blobStore := blob.NewStore(leecherDataDir)
	cfg.TorrentDataOpener = func(info *metainfo.Info) Data {
		return blobStore.OpenTorrent(info)
	}
	leecher, _ := NewClient(&cfg)
	defer leecher.Close()
	leecherGreeting, _, _ := leecher.AddTorrentSpec(func() (ret *TorrentSpec) {
		ret = TorrentSpecFromMetaInfo(mi)
		ret.ChunkSize = 2
		return
	}())
	// TODO: The piece state publishing is kinda jammed in here until I have a
	// more thorough test.
	go func() {
		s := leecherGreeting.pieceStateChanges.Subscribe()
		defer s.Close()
		for i := range s.Values {
			log.Print(i)
		}
		log.Print("finished")
	}()
	leecherGreeting.AddPeers([]Peer{
		Peer{
			IP:   missinggo.AddrIP(seeder.ListenAddr()),
			Port: missinggo.AddrPort(seeder.ListenAddr()),
		},
	})
	r := leecherGreeting.NewReader()
	defer r.Close()
	_greeting, err := ioutil.ReadAll(r)
	if err != nil {
		t.Fatalf("%q %s", string(_greeting), err)
	}
	greeting := string(_greeting)
	if greeting != testutil.GreetingFileContents {
		t.Fatal(":(")
	}
}
